5 Reasons Your AC Isn't Turning On (and How to Fix It)

Key Takeaways:

  • An AC not turning on is usually due to a power supply issue, faulty thermostat, burned out capacitor or contractor, or a clogged condensate line.
  • It’s normal for an air conditioner to occasionally need a new part over the course of its life. A faulty capacitor, for instance, isn’t necessarily a sign of a more serious problem with the appliance.
  • An air conditioner that frequently trips a breaker or breaks down repeatedly despite repairs should be checked out by a professional HVAC technician.
  • Basic seasonal maintenance can help you avoid the most common AC problems and extend the lifespan of the appliance.

Before You Call a Technician: Quick Checks Anyone Can Do

An air conditioner that won’t power on might have a simple explanation. Before you call a pro, first perform some basic AC troubleshooting.

  • Confirm whether any indicator lights are on. If any lights are on, the appliance is drawing power, and the problem has some other cause.
  • Make sure that the power cord is fitted securely into the outlet, and check that the breaker wasn’t tripped. If necessary, reset the breaker at your home’s electrical panel.
  • Depending on the type of system, an air conditioner not working could be because of a flipped maintenance or emergency switch. Even a window unit may be plugged into an outlet controlled by a wall switch. If your AC is switch dependent, check that the switch is in the “on” position.
  • Check the temperature controls. The thermostat should be set to “cool” and the programmed temperature below the current air temperature of the room. If the thermostat is unresponsive, check the batteries or wiring.

If you still can’t turn the cool air on, proceed to investigating the condensate drain line for a clog, replacing or cleaning the air filter, or checking internal electrical components. Depending on your appetite for DIY work, you may need the help of a technician.

5 Reasons Your AC Isn’t Turning On and How to Fix Each One

While an air conditioner can fail for any number of reasons, there are five issues in particular that account for most malfunctions.

1. Tripped Circuit Breaker

The problem: ACs use a lot of power, especially upon startup when the compressor engages. If there are too many appliances drawing power from the same circuit, or if there’s a power surge, the breaker may trip as a safety measure.

How to solve it: Reset the breaker at the electrical panel to restore power. Move the tripped breaker from the center position to “off,” then flip it back to “on.” If the breaker continues to trip and you aren’t overloading the circuit with too many appliances, have an electrician troubleshoot.

2. Faulty or Miscalibrated Thermostat

The problem: An unresponsive or bad thermostat stops you from controlling your air conditioner. It’s also possible that the thermostat is functional, but the settings need to be checked.

How to solve it: Confirm that your thermostat is set to “cool” and the desired temperature is cooler than the current room temperature. If you have an AC not responding to thermostat inputs, check that the batteries or in-wall wires are in good condition. If your home uses a smart thermostat, confirm that it’s connected to Wi-Fi. You can also reset the thermostat per the manufacturer’s recommendations.

3. Condensate Drain Line Clog

The problem: The moisture that an air conditioner extracts from the air flows out of the appliance through a condensate drain line. Over time, this line can become clogged with algae, mold, or fine debris, causing water to back up into the drain pan and triggering a float switch that shuts the system down.

How to solve it: Confirm a clog by examining the indoor end of the drain line and checking the drain pan for pooling water. Use a wet/dry vacuum at the outside end of the line to clear the obstruction.

4. Bad Capacitor

The problem: An AC’s capacitor delivers a charge to jumpstart the compressor and fan. If it fails, the AC can’t function properly.

How to solve it: Replacing a capacitor can be a dangerous job because the component stores an electrical charge even when the appliance is powered off. It’s best to leave the work to a professional.

 5. Faulty Contactor

The problem: A contactor is a specialized relay switch that receives a low-voltage signal from the thermostat and turns on the high-voltage power to the compressor and fan motor. When a contactor corrodes or becomes stuck in the open state, the AC won’t work.

How to solve it: A faulty contactor needs to be replaced. The component itself is not particularly expensive, but there is again the risk of electric shock because of the nature of the work. Calling a technician is the best move.

What Each AC Component Does When It Fails to Start

Understanding how the various mechanisms in your AC system fail can help you resolve a breakdown more quickly and effectively.

  • Breaker: A breaker is essentially a failsafe to break the flow of electricity when a circuit is overloaded. If an AC fails to start, it could be because there was a fault or power surge on its circuit. This would trip the breaker, cutting power to the appliance.
  • Thermostat: The thermostat is your point of control for the AC. It measures the temperature in your home and signals when the compressor and fan should engage to initiate cooling. If the thermostat isn’t receiving power, then it can’t communicate with the AC unit. If it’s miscalibrated or incorrectly registering the room temperature, the AC won’t turn on at the appropriate time.
  • Capacitor: The capacitor gives a boost of energy to start the compressor and fan motor. Much like a battery, it needs to be replaced after some time because it just doesn’t deliver the power the AC needs to get going.
  • Contactor: A contactor is a switch that facilitates the delivery of high-voltage power to the compressor when closed, or in the “on” position. A contactor can be the reason for a dysfunctional AC when the switch is stuck in the open position or when it’s corroded enough to impair the flow of electricity to the compressor.

How to Prevent Your AC From Failing to Start in the Future

Some routine AC maintenance will help you go longer before experiencing a breakdown. Here are the basics:

  • Clean or replace the air filter every one to three months.
  • Check the outdoor condenser unit weekly and after storms to keep it free of leaves, twigs, and other debris.
  • Flush the condensate drain line every so often to prevent clogs.
  • Schedule an annual HVAC checkup with a professional technician.
  • Monitor the system for leaks, strange noises, off smells, and signs of corrosion or deterioration.

  • Can a dirty filter stop an AC from turning on?

    A dirty filter is usually a performance problem and doesn’t prevent the AC from turning on, but an especially dirty filter could inhibit airflow to such an extent that the compressor and fan motor shut down to prevent overheating.

  • How do I reset my AC unit?

    Reset your AC system by turning it off at the thermostat, then cutting power to the circuit at the breaker box. Flip the breaker to “off” and wait one minute before turning it back to the “on” position. Then return to the thermostat and set the system to “cool.”

  • Why does my AC keep tripping the circuit breaker?

    Faulty electrical components in an AC can draw too much power and trip a breaker. The breaker will also trip if too many appliances are running on the same circuit. The problem could also reside within the electrical system itself, and the circuit may be too old or damaged to handle an AC’s power demands.

  • When is an AC that won't start beyond repair?

    Capacitors and contactors are usually worth replacing, but if the compressor fails, it might be worth replacing the entire appliance. As a rule of thumb, plan on replacement if the appliance is more than 10 to 15 years old, or if the repair costs exceed 50% of the price of a new unit.
